Learn about CVE-2017-17053, a Linux kernel vulnerability allowing local attackers to exploit a use-after-free flaw. Find mitigation steps and prevention measures here.
In the Linux kernel version earlier than 4.12.10, a vulnerability exists in the init_new_context function that can be exploited by a local attacker to achieve a use-after-free or cause unintended consequences by running a specially crafted program.
Understanding CVE-2017-17053
This CVE involves a flaw in the Linux kernel that mishandles errors during LDT table allocation when forking a new process, potentially leading to a use-after-free vulnerability.
What is CVE-2017-17053?
The vulnerability in the Linux kernel version prior to 4.12.10 allows a local attacker to exploit a use-after-free vulnerability or cause unintended consequences by executing a specially crafted program.
The Impact of CVE-2017-17053
The vulnerability enables a potential attacker within the system to exploit a use-after-free vulnerability or potentially cause other unintended consequences by executing a specifically crafted program.
Technical Details of CVE-2017-17053
This section provides detailed technical information about the vulnerability.
Vulnerability Description
The init_new_context function in the Linux kernel before version 4.12.10 does not correctly handle errors from LDT table allocation when forking a new process, allowing a local attacker to achieve a use-after-free or possibly have other unspecified impacts by running a specially crafted program.
Affected Systems and Versions
Exploitation Mechanism
The vulnerability can be exploited by a local attacker running a specially crafted program to trigger the use-after-free vulnerability.
Mitigation and Prevention
Protecting systems from CVE-2017-17053 requires immediate actions and long-term security practices.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ates